WritingFix: prompts, lessons, and resources for writing classrooms Teacher Talk Richard Firsten is a retired ESOL teacher, teacher-trainer and columnist I taught ESOL for over 35 years before I retired. During those years I was a classroom teacher, associate director of a university English language institute, and author of a number of textbooks both for students and teachers. Being retired, I have the luxury of time to observe how everyday native speakers are using the language in a variety of settings and contexts, and I have noticed some remarkable things going on that have taken hold where 20 years ago they never would have. Here’s a case in point, something that really did happen to me.

The Grammar Casino | an ESL exercise to test grammar in a fun activity, editable game template Welcome to the grammar casino! If your grammar is solid, you can win it all or if not, lose your shirt. This is a great review game or can be used to target specific weak areas. If you like this game check out At the Track! It's similar but with a twist. The downloads: These are in .doc (Word) format so you can change the template to suit your language needs. Formatted A4 size: the grammar casino (full color) the grammar casino (b/w) Formatted Letter size: the grammar casino (full color) the grammar casino (b/w) How to play: Materials needed: 1 copy of the game board per student Students start with one hundred points Students read the first sentence. The line under each sentence can be used to rewrite sentences with a mistake in them or it can be used to translate correct sentences into L1. If students lose all of their points: You will have plenty of students that let it all ride every time.
